It's really more of a step up than a step down when you look at the details.

Quote

while Pitchford remains CEO of The Gearbox Entertainment Company (the holding company of Gearbox Software) and president of Gearbox Studios, which will oversee Gearbox's development of film and television shows.

Quote

In a tweet, Pitchford explained that he will be responsible for "high level creative and business strategy" " while also serving as a "hybrid" chief creative officer where necessary.

 

 

So he's not getting any less money, influence, or power. He just gets to be a bit less the face of the studio, perhaps in the hope that the jokes at his expense recede.
